You know, it's kinda of obvious now when Theramore is going to get trashed...in the Jaina book.
Well, we'll know the details then but didn't they say it was part of the pre-MoP event?
its posible that it will be just like the shattering book/elemental invasion event.
both happened at the same time, and portrayed roughly the same events (thrall leaving the horde for nagrand, orgrimmar in flames, ect) but the book version was more canon than the ingame version.
its posible that the theramoore attack happens both ingame and in the book, but the book version will have more details than what can be seen in the game, and will be more canonic
